Photoactivatable fluorescence enhanced behaviour of benzo[c][1,2,5]oxadiazole-dressing tetraphenylethene

A photoactivatable benzo[c][1,2,5]oxadiazole-dressing tetraphenylethylene (TPE) was developed. The optical performance results indicate that UV-irradiation can lead to remarkable emission enhancement in solution states due to the cyclization of the TPE component. Application in the solid state confirmed that it has a potential to serve as a photoactivatable visualized material.
